P21EE
Cylinder 10 Injector B Circuit Low
P21EE is an OBD-II diagnostic trouble code meaning: Cylinder 10 Injector B Circuit Low. Common causes: cylinder 10 injector malfunction, open or short circuit in control circuit. Estimated repair cost: $17–89.
Symptoms
- Unstable engine operation
- Increased fuel consumption
- Power Loss
- Check Engine Light Is On
- Misfire in cylinder 10
Causes
- Cylinder 10 injector malfunction
- Open or short circuit in control circuit
- Poor contact in the injector connectors
- Engine control unit malfunction
- Wiring harness damage
How to Fix
- Check the resistance of the injector of cylinder 10
- Inspect wiring and connectors for damage
- Check voltage at injector control circuit
- If necessary, replace the injector
- Check the operation of the engine control unit
